Output 2d94abfd17c5bb511bfdf788cc8f1e0df61ec2c886ab865f6942513be1d5da52:15

value
1129936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5895d738e33ca8dec8759f037f0cf2b0af4f23c7 OP_EQUAL
address
39mQtYGq4zoFv56KXWnbB9Zs9McSSdr72x
transaction
2d94abfd17c5bb511bfdf788cc8f1e0df61ec2c886ab865f6942513be1d5da52
confirmations
57
spent
false